STAFF.
Details of the staff of the Department in December, 1924,
are given below. All are whole-time officers with the exception
of two of the mortuary keepers. Officers to whose salary no
contribution is made under the Public Health Acts or by Exchequer
grants are marked with *.
Medical Officer of Health.. F. G. Caley, M.A., M.B., D.P.H.
Deputy M.O.H. and Tuberculosis
Officer .. A. W.Forrest,M.A.,M.D.,D.P.H.
Assistant M.O.H. and Assistant
Tub. Officer .. J.J.MacDonnell,M.B.,B.S.,D.P.H
